iShares S&P Small-Cap 600 Value ETF
694 hedge funds and large institutions have $3.82B invested in iShares S&P Small-Cap 600 Value ETF in 2022 Q3 according to their latest regulatory filings, with 44 funds opening new positions, 191 increasing their positions, 291 reducing their positions, and 128 closing their positions.
